Did I mention we were boarded by the Mexican Navy while in Baja... very
interesting experience. They came along side with a skiff... eight
sailors (all toting M-16s or similar) and the officer with a sidearm.
Very professional. We were the only boat in sight... with Moorings
plastered all over, so it was pretty obvious we were charterers. The
officer and one crew came aboard, while the others stayed on the skiff.

The officer asked to see the boat documentation, but was mostly
interested in the fishing permits (up-to-date) courtesy of the Moorings.
His English wasn't that great, but basically they were looking for
poachers. After several attempts he accepted some water for himself and
his crew... damn hot day.
